aluminum radiator off eBay

so I installed an all aluminum radiator today that I got off eBay. only paid $136.53 with shipping and taxes. it actually fit good with the exception of the lower shroud tabs that had to be filed down. the upper shroud bolts weren't included, luckily I already had some M6 x 1.0 x 12 screws left over from something else I was working on.












both lower tabs were filed down
